FANCL是范可尼贫血(Fanconi anemia,FA)通路中的一个关键基因,属于FA核心复合物的一部分。FA基因家族(FANC基因家族)由多个基因组成,这些基因编码的蛋白质共同参与DNA损伤修复,特别是修复DNA链间交联(ICLs)。FANCL作为E3泛素连接酶复合物的核心组分,负责泛素化FANCD2和FANCI,这是FA通路激活的关键步骤。FANCL的突变会导致FA,这是一种罕见的遗传性疾病,表现为骨髓衰竭、先天性畸形和癌症易感性(尤其是白血病和鳞状细胞癌)。FANCL突变会破坏FA通路的正常功能,导致细胞对DNA交联剂高度敏感,并增加基因组不稳定性。FANCL过表达可能影响细胞周期调控和DNA修复效率,但具体机制尚不完全清楚;而FANCL表达降低或缺失会显著削弱FA通路功能,导致DNA损伤积累和细胞凋亡增加。FANCL与其他FA基因(如FANCA、FANCC、FANCD2等)协同作用,共同维持基因组稳定性。FA基因家族的共性在于它们编码的蛋白质形成一个多蛋白复合物,参与识别和修复DNA损伤,尤其是通过同源重组修复(HR)途径处理DNA链间交联。FANCL的功能异常不仅与FA相关,还可能与其他癌症和衰老过程有关,因为DNA修复缺陷是这些病理过程的共同特征。

The Fanconi anemia complementation group (FANC) currently includes FANCA, FANCB, FANCC, FANCD1 (also called BRCA2), FANCD2, FANCE, FANCF, FANCG, FANCI, FANCJ (also called BRIP1), FANCL, FANCM and FANCN (also called PALB2). The previously defined group FANCH is the same as FANCA. Fanconi anemia is a genetically heterogeneous recessive disorder characterized by cytogenetic instability, hypersensitivity to DNA crosslinking agents, increased chromosomal breakage, and defective DNA repair. The members of the Fanconi anemia complementation group do not share sequence similarity; they are related by their assembly into a common nuclear protein complex. This gene encodes the protein for complementation group L. Alternative splicing results in two transcript variants encoding different isoforms. [provided by RefSeq, Jul 2008]
